> >> > struct crypto_aes_ctx {
> >> > u32 key_length;
> >> >+ u32 _pad1;
> >>
> >> Why is this pad required? Do you want special alignment of the keys?
> >
> >Because the key is loaded in 64bit in this patch, I want to align the
> >key with 64bit address.
>
> Than this won't work all the time. To make it bulletproof
> - set .cra_alignmask in the glue code properly
> - use the attribute aligned thing
> - retrieve your private struct via crypto_tfm_ctx_aligned()
>
> You might want to take a look on padlock-aes.c. The same thing is done
> there but instead of crypto_tfm_ctx_aligned() a private function is
> used (to let the compiler optimize most of the code away). Depending on
> Herbert's mood you might get away with this as well (what would be
> probably the case since you might prefer to do it asm) :)
